Online leadership degrees can be earned as a bachelors, masters, MBA and doctorate. These degree programs will teach students in the ways of current business practices, as well as leading and organizing employees, managing projects, plus many more. Other courses will cover decision-making, communications, logistics and marketing. Most companies will hire graduates with associates and bachelors degrees for entry-level positions. Advanced degrees are almost undoubtedly needed for high-paying careers as CEOs, publishers, city managers, senior administration, and more.
According to the US Bureau of Labor Statistics, employment of individuals with management and leadership degrees is expected to grow at a less-than-average 2-percent rate. The scientific, professional, and technical fields are expected to be the most promising areas for new careers. The annual median salary in 2007 for general and operations managers was almost $104,000, while top-earners made over $150,000.
